Instructions
1: Cube your chicken and set aside. 2: In a bowl, mix flour, egg, cold water,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per together, then set aside. 3: Toss chicken in cornstarch. 4: After covering in cornstarch, toss chicken in the liquidy flour mixture. 5: Pour oil in a pan and heat on high. 6: Fry each chicken cube for about 3-4 minutes on each side until golden brown, then remove from the pan. 7: In another pan, make the sauce by combining orange juice, orange zest, sweetener, soy sauce, garlic, ginger, and cornstarch mixed with water. 8: Simmer the sauce for 2-3 minutes. 9: Toss the cooked chicken in the sauce. 10: Serve over rice and top with sesame seeds and green onions for garnish.View original recipe
